This is a collection of 36 different mint stamps from Tanzania, likely issued between the late 1970s and early 1990s. The stamps showcase the nation's diverse wildlife, culture, and history, featuring colorful depictions of native animals, birds, fish, and flora. Such collections are often assembled for topical collectors and provide a broad overview of the country's philatelic output.

Following the union of Tanganyika and Zanzibar in 1964, Tanzania's postage stamps became a vibrant medium for expressing national identity, promoting tourism by highlighting its natural wonders, and commemorating significant events.
